  • Abstract
    Liquid dispensing can be a very tough job especially when dealing with various liquids of different viscosity. Furthermore, to reach a precise result, it is very difficult to achieve. This paper presents a liquid dispensing system with real-time automatic control by using an analytical balancer reading as a feedback with additional mathematical PWM algorithm to optimize the dispensing process. Using the specifically custom build nozzle, the dispensing process can be accomplished in shorter duration together with higher accuracy and precision.
